深入理解django-cms:现代Web发布平台
"django-cms是基于Django框架构建的开源内容管理系统,用于现代网页发布平台。它提供了一套开箱即用的功能,适用于常见的CMS需求,并且可由开发者进行定制和扩展,以适应特定项目需求。该系统包含了教程、实践指南和详细参考文档,适合从安装到创建自定义应用的新手开发者进行学习。" django-cms是基于Python的Django框架开发的内容管理系统(CMS),旨在为用户提供一个功能齐全、高度可定制的网站构建平台。作为一个现代化的Web发布工具,django-cms不仅满足了基本的CMS功能,如页面编辑、内容管理、多语言支持等,还允许开发者通过其强大的API和插件系统进行深度定制,以适应各种复杂的需求。 **教程**: 对于初次接触django-cms的开发者,教程部分提供了从安装到创建自己的附加应用程序的详细步骤。这些教程涵盖了安装django-cms、设置项目环境、理解工作流程、创建和管理页面以及部署网站的基础知识。通过这些教程,新手可以快速上手并理解django-cms的基本操作。 **实践指南**: 实践指南是一系列实用的步骤指南,帮助用户解决特定问题或完成特定任务。这些指南可能包括如何添加新的内容类型、实现自定义工作流、集成第三方服务,或者优化性能等方面的内容。实践指南以实际操作为主,使开发者能够通过实践来学习和掌握django-cms的高级特性。 **关键主题**: 这部分深入讨论了django-cms的关键特性,如权限管理、多语言支持、菜单系统、插件机制等。这些关键主题提供了对django-cms核心功能的深入理解,帮助开发者更好地利用这些功能来构建复杂的网站架构。 **参考文档**: 详尽的参考文档覆盖了所有的API、模型、视图、模板标签和过滤器等,是开发者在编写代码时的重要参考资料。开发者可以通过查阅这些文档来查找具体的函数、方法或类,以便在项目中正确使用。 **开发与社区**: 这部分内容可能涉及到开发流程、版本控制、贡献指南、社区资源和活动等,旨在鼓励开发者参与项目的开发和改进,以及如何获取社区的支持和帮助。 **版本发布及升级信息**: 包括版本更新日志、升级指南和迁移策略,帮助用户了解每个新版本带来的变化,以及如何安全有效地将现有站点升级到最新版本。 **使用django-cms**: 这部分可能是关于如何有效利用django-cms来构建和管理网站的综合指南,包括最佳实践、技巧和常见问题解答。 总而言之,django-cms不仅是一个功能强大的CMS,还是一个学习Django框架的理想示例,为开发者提供了丰富的学习资源和工具,以实现高效、灵活的网站开发。
剩余244页未读,继续阅读
- 粉丝: 0
- 资源: 1
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- zlib-1.2.12压缩包解析与技术要点
- 微信小程序滑动选项卡源码模版发布
- Unity虚拟人物唇同步插件Oculus Lipsync介绍
- Nginx 1.18.0版本WinSW自动安装与管理指南
- Java Swing和JDBC实现的ATM系统源码解析
- 掌握Spark Streaming与Maven集成的分布式大数据处理
- 深入学习推荐系统:教程、案例与项目实践
- Web开发者必备的取色工具软件介绍
- C语言实现李春葆数据结构实验程序
- 超市管理系统开发:asp+SQL Server 2005实战
- Redis伪集群搭建教程与实践
- 掌握网络活动细节:Wireshark v3.6.3网络嗅探工具详解
- 全面掌握美赛:建模、分析与编程实现教程
- Java图书馆系统完整项目源码及SQL文件解析
- PCtoLCD2002软件:高效图片和字符取模转换
- Java开发的体育赛事在线购票系统源码分析